Getting There

  • Metro

    If you are starting from Termini Station, take Line A (the orange line) in the direction of Anagnina. After three stops, get off at Re di Roma station. Once you exit the station, turn left onto Via Re di Roma. Continue walking straight for about 5 minutes until you reach Piazza dei Re di Roma.

  • Bus

    From the Colosseum, walk to the bus stop at Piazza del Colosseo. Take bus number 81 in the direction of Stazione Tiburtina. After about 8 stops, get off at the stop named Re di Roma. From there, walk back a short distance to Piazza dei Re di Roma.

  • Walking

    If you are near the Basilica di San Giovanni in Laterano, you can walk to Piazza dei Re di Roma. Head southeast on Via del Laterano towards Via Carlo Felice. Continue straight onto Via Merulana, then turn left onto Via Re di Roma. Continue walking straight for about 10 minutes until you arrive at the piazza.

Discover more about Piazza dei Re di Roma

Piazza dei Re di Roma is a lively and picturesque town square located in the vibrant heart of Rome, a city known for its rich history and stunning architecture. This square serves as a central hub where locals and tourists alike gather to enjoy the vibrant atmosphere that characterizes Roman life. Surrounded by charming cafes, shops, and historical buildings, the piazza offers a perfect spot to relax, enjoy a cup of espresso, or simply watch the world go by. The square is often animated with street performers and local artists, adding to its lively ambiance and making it an ideal place for photography enthusiasts. Visitors will appreciate the unique blend of modern life and historical significance that Piazza dei Re di Roma embodies. The square is not only a beautiful gathering place but also a gateway to exploring the surrounding areas, which are rich in cultural landmarks and attractions. As you stroll through the piazza, take a moment to admire the intricate architectural details of nearby buildings that narrate stories of the past. Beyond its aesthetic appeal, the piazza is also a reflection of the community spirit, with local markets and events often taking place, showcasing Roman culture and traditions. Whether you are looking to immerse yourself in the local lifestyle, indulge in delicious Italian cuisine at nearby restaurants, or simply enjoy a leisurely afternoon in a historic setting, Piazza dei Re di Roma is an essential stop on your Roman adventure. This town square captures the essence of Rome, offering a delightful experience that resonates with the city’s allure and charm.
